Woman, 22, charged after Brighton protest speech

A woman who was arrested on suspicion of supporting Hamas after a protest in Brighton has been charged.

Hanin Barghouti, 22, of Eaton Grove, Hove, has been charged with supporting a proscribed organisation contrary to Section 12 of the Terrorism Act 2000.

Hamas is proscribed as a terrorist organisation by the UK government.

Sussex Police said the charge followed a speech made on 8 October after the attacks by Hamas against Israel.

Ms Barghouti has been released on bail to appear at Westminster Magistrates' Court on 17 November, the force said.
